company logo

Digital Marketing Manager

IHG.com

Office

Thailand

Full Time

With panoramic views of the Gulf of Thailand, Holiday Inn Resort Vana Nava Hua Hin is the first Holiday Inn water park resort in Asia, located in the popular seaside getaway of Hua Hin, Thailand.

At Holiday Inn® our job is to bring the joy of travel to everyone.  That’s where you come in. When you’re part of the Holiday Inn Hotels & Resorts brand you’re more than just a job title. 

We love the individual talents, interests and dreams that make you who you are. And because your career will be as unique as you are, we’ll give you all the tailored support you need to make a great start, be involved and grow.

We look for people who are friendly, welcoming and full of life; people who are always finding ways to make every guest’s experience an enjoyable one. So whoever you are, whatever you love doing, bring your passion to Holiday Inn and IHG and we’ll make sure you’ll have room to be yourself.

Job Overview

The  Digital Marketing Manager is responsible for the development, implementation and performance of the distribution channel strategy, aligned to the hotel stay brand, loyalty brand and outlet marketing strategies, in order to achieve low cost book direct revenue, market share growth and brand preference. The role drives channel performance via the management of social media best practices, consulting on optimised hotel marketing content, and ensures integrated use of new and existing IHG tools, platforms and systems. It also is responsible for compliance, management and performance across Websites (WEB), Central Reservation Offices (CRO), Global Distribution Systems (GDS), and On Line Travel Agents (OTA) to increase revenue through direct low cost system contribution.  

Qualifications And Requirements

Qualifications –

  • Degree in Marketing, Communications, Business Administration or an equivalent combination of education and work-related experience

Experience –

  • 3 years experience in Marketing, Distribution Marketing, Digital Marketing, Brand management, Public Relations, Marketing Communications or Revenue management.
  • Advertising Agency, Public Relations, Travel industry system connectivity, Online Travel Agents, Central Reservation Office background or combination of any above are highly desired related industries.

Required Skills and Abilities –

  •  Demonstrated expertise of online marketing as well as offline
  • Creative, innovative, and aware of new technology trends in the travel industry
  • Engaged in social media platforms (e.g. Facebook)
  • Proficiency in Excel, Word, PowerPoint, Photoshop skills will be a plus
  • Strong communication skills in English. Local language and source market language a plus
  • Team Player and excellent interpersonal skills
  • Fundamental skills to project management

Digital Marketing Manager

Office

Thailand

Full Time

October 14, 2025

IHG.com

IHGhotels